I did a code check on the truck and received this code.
P 0230
Which from looking at Dodge code chart it says this - Transfer Pump (Lift Pump) Circ Out Of Range.
Does this possibly mean a bad wire, fuse or dead pump?
I don't hear the pump when bumping the key. Only clicks

You need to check the fuel pressure at Wide Open Throttle. You must have 5 psi minimum. If not, replace the lift pump or upgrade it. There is no way around the lift pump issue, unless you dont mind replacing the injector pump at $1000+ a shot.
That being said, if you are going to drive this truck anywhere - you MUST have a fuel pressure guage installed in the cab.

i don't know if you can swing it(i sure know what it's like to be broke)but i got my first fuel gauge from jegs, none lighted machcnical gauge but it was only about $35 plus s&h.don't waste your $$ on the low fuel pressure warning light.i had a brand new stock cummins lift pump go bad.took out my injection pump, the light never even lit.the others are right though if there's any question at ALL about the lift pump DON'T drive the truck.if the ip goes out it will cost ya at least a grand.i'v been through it tooooo many times.
